Genadendal-The first mission station in South Africa

On Thursday 17 December 2009 District Apostle Barnes visited the congregation of Genadendal to fulfill a promise made some time ago.
Accompanying him was Apostle W Diedericks, Bishops A November, B Adonis, K Schoeman and Bishop P Thompson, whose grandmother was born in Genadendal in the late 1890’s. It was a special experience for the bishop to return to the place of his ancestry.
The mission of Genadendal was established as the first of its kind in South Africa when, in 1837 the Moravian church in Germany commissioned the spreading of the gospel to the local inhabitants of the area. Many descendants of the first believers baptized during the 1890’s are still found in the town.
